Rubber foam insulation is an advanced solution widely used in various industries due to its exceptional properties and versatile applications. This material is crafted from synthetic rubber and is designed to provide thermal insulation, sound absorption, and moisture control. One of the most significant advantages of rubber foam insulation is its excellent thermal performance. Its closed-cell structure minimizes heat transfer, making it an ideal choice for temperature-sensitive environments. This characteristic is particularly beneficial in HVAC systems, where maintaining consistent temperatures can lead to increased energy efficiency. By reducing energy costs, businesses can save money while also contributing to a more sustainable operation.

In addition to thermal insulation, rubber foam exhibits outstanding sound insulation properties. The inherent density and elasticity of the material allow it to absorb sound waves effectively, making it suitable for applications in sound-sensitive environments, such as recording studios, theaters, and hospitals. By utilizing rubber foam insulation, businesses can create quieter spaces that enhance productivity and improve the overall experience for occupants.

Moisture resistance is another critical feature of rubber foam insulation. Unlike some traditional insulation materials, rubber foam does not absorb water, reducing the risk of mold and mildew growth. This makes it particularly valuable in applications where humidity is a concern, such as refrigeration units and commercial kitchens. The ability to mitigate moisture-related issues not only protects the integrity of the insulation but also contributes to a healthier indoor environment.

Durability is a key benefit that further enhances the value of rubber foam insulation. This material is resistant to chemicals, oils, and UV radiation, allowing it to maintain its performance and integrity in challenging conditions. Its longevity makes it a cost-effective solution, as it typically requires less frequent replacement compared to other insulation materials. Industries such as automotive, marine, and aerospace utilize rubber foam for its robustness and reliability, ensuring that vehicles and equipment operate optimally over time.

Moreover, rubber foam insulation is highly flexible, allowing for easy installation in various spaces and shapes. Its adaptability makes it an excellent choice for complex industrial applications, where traditional insulation materials might struggle to conform to irregular surfaces. This flexibility not only simplifies the installation process but also enhances the overall efficiency of insulation projects, ensuring that all areas are adequately covered.
